The VACON0100-3L-0012-5-R02+SEBJ industrial drive operates with an input voltage of 380-500 V 3-phase AC, outputs a frequency range of 0-320 Hz, and offers a maximum output current of 19.2 A for 2 seconds. Part of the VACON 100 Industrial Drives series by Danfoss, it features IP21 protection and advanced communications such as Modbus RTU and PROFINET.

Product Description:

The VACON0100-3L-0012-5-R02+SEBJ Industrial Drive is manufactured by Danfoss. Danfoss designs reliable industrial drives built for efficiency and precise control. This drive supports three-phase input operation with an input current of 12 A. It is designed for a main voltage ranging from 380 to 500 V. The enclosure size for this model is MR4 for protection and durability in industrial use.

The VACON0100-3L-0012-5-R02+SEBJ Industrial Drive dimension is 357 x 152 mm which provides a compact design for installation. The mounting dimensions are 315 x 137 x 24 mm which support easy placement in control systems. The cooling is maintained with an airflow quantity of 45 m³/h for stable performance. The total mass of the drive is 6 kg which makes it lightweight for its capacity. The main, motor, and brake cable size is 3x2.5+2.5 mm² for reliable electrical connections. The recommended fuse size for protection is 16 A. The main terminal cable size is 1–4 standard for compatibility with installation requirements. The continuous current capacity of the drive is 12.0 A. It delivers an overload current capability of 13.2 A for demanding loads. Under high load ability, the continuous current is 9.6 A. High load ability input current is rated at 9.3 A. The maximum current capacity of this unit is 19.2 A.

The VACON0100-3L-0012-5-R02+SEBJ Industrial Drive has a brake resistor type of BRR 0022 which confirms controlled braking. The brake resistance value is specified at 63 ohms. The starting delay for the drive is 6 seconds which provides a controlled startup. The output frequency range is adjustable between 0 and 320 Hz and frequency resolution is 0.01 Hz for accurate control over motor speed.

Frequently Asked Questions about VACON0100-3L-0012-5-R02+SEBJ:

Q: Why does the VACON0100-3L-0012-5-R02+SEBJ industrial drive use a 6-second start delay?

A: The start delay helps minimize mechanical stress on motors during power-up. It ensures smoother startups and protects downstream components from sudden inrush currents.

Q: What advantage does the 0.01 Hz frequency resolution offer?

A: The VACON0100-3L-0012-5-R02+SEBJ drive allows fine-tuned speed adjustments for high-precision motor applications. This is crucial in systems requiring minimal RPM deviations.

Q: How does the MR4 enclosure benefit this model?

A: The MR4 enclosure enhances dust and moisture protection in industrial environments. It ensures long-term drive reliability in harsh conditions.

Q: How does a brake resistor like BRR 0022 contribute to system safety?

A: The BRR 0022 resistor absorbs regenerative energy during deceleration. It prevents overvoltage conditions in the VACON0100-3L-0012-5-R02+SEBJ industrial drive.

Q: What’s the purpose of the 63-ohm brake resistance?

A: The 63-ohm value provides controlled braking torque. It balances energy dissipation and heat management during braking cycles.
